The Southern Theatre

Accessibility

Both the building and theater are accessible.
There are all-gender multi-stall restrooms in the first floor lobby.
Parking
Public Parking is located in the Courtyard Marriott Ramp located next to The Southern Theater, 1500 Washington Ave S.
A special discount is applied for patrons of the Southern Theater ($5.50 for 4 hours in the ramp*)! You can follow the steps below to pay for your spot in the ramp.
*Important note: This discount can be overridden by event pricing as determined by the parking ramp. Please check signage at the ramp when parking to avoid any unexpected charges.
1. Enter the Ramp
2. Park
3. Remember License Plate #
4. Proceed to the Southern Theater
5. Once at the theater, scan the QR Code posted immediately to the left as you enter our front door. You will be prompted to enter your License Plate # and payment information
6. Click Purchase
7. You will receive a text message confirming your vehicle details and parking timeframe
Metered parking is also available on the streets surrounding the theater: Washington Ave, S 15th Ave, and Cedar Ave.
Bus and bike
Closest bus stop is: Cedar Ave S. & Washington Ave S. It's served by lines 7, 22, 118, 252.
Coming by Green Line? Get off at the West Bank Station and take the stairs up to Cedar Ave, walk north on Cedar Ave around the curve and The Southern Theater will be on your right.
Bike parking is available near Town Hall Brewery, on the corner of S Washington Ave, and next to the parking ramp.
